Getting There

  • LRT (Light Rail Transit)

    If you are near any LRT station, take the LRT train heading towards the KL Sentral station. The Kuala Lumpur Railway Station is a short walk from KL Sentral. Once you arrive at KL Sentral, exit the station and head towards the main exit. From there, walk straight down Jalan Tun Sambanthan until you reach the junction with Jalan Sultan Hishamuddin. Turn right onto Jalan Sultan Hishamuddin, and you will see the Kuala Lumpur Railway Station on your left.

  • Monorail

    Board the Monorail at any station and travel towards the Bukit Bintang station. Once you arrive at Bukit Bintang, exit the station and walk to Jalan Bukit Bintang to catch a taxi or Grab to the Kuala Lumpur Railway Station. You can also walk to the nearest LRT station (Bukit Bintang LRT Station) and take the LRT to KL Sentral, then follow the previous instructions to reach the railway station.

  • Taxi or Ride-Hailing Service

    You can easily request a taxi or a ride-hailing service like Grab from your current location. Just input 'Kuala Lumpur Railway Station' or '110, Jalan Sultan Hishamuddin' as your destination. The driver will take you directly to the railway station, and you won't have to worry about navigating.

  • Walking

    If you are staying nearby, you can walk to Kuala Lumpur Railway Station. Look for Jalan Sultan Hishamuddin, and head towards the railway station. The station's distinctive architecture makes it easy to spot as you approach. Depending on your starting point, you can use Google Maps for precise walking directions.

Discover more about Kuala Lumpur Railway Station

The Kuala Lumpur Railway Station is not merely a transportation hub; it is a breathtaking architectural masterpiece that captivates visitors with its unique blend of Moorish, Mughal, and British colonial influences. Opened in 1910, this historic station features grand arches, ornate domes, and intricate detailing that provide a glimpse into the past while serving the modern needs of travelers. Upon entering, you are greeted by a spacious hall adorned with beautiful tiles and decorative elements that reflect Malaysia's diverse cultural heritage. The station is surrounded by lush gardens and is located near several other attractions, making it an ideal starting point for your journey through Kuala Lumpur. As you explore the area, take the time to appreciate the meticulously crafted facades and the charming atmosphere that surrounds the station. The railway station is not only a functional space but also a popular backdrop for photography, attracting both locals and tourists alike. Visitors often gather to snap pictures against its stunning exterior, which is particularly photogenic during sunset. Additionally, the station houses various shops and cafes where you can grab a bite or a refreshing drink while soaking in the historic ambiance. Whether you are catching a train, enjoying a leisurely stroll, or simply marveling at its beauty, the Kuala Lumpur Railway Station is an essential stop in your Kuala Lumpur adventure, offering a rich tapestry of history and culture in the heart of the city.
